Declining Quality
This review would have been 2 stars, but there are other factors that I will list below as to why it's 3.I have been using Pratt brand boxes for over a few years now (several hundred, various sizes). When I first started purchasing them, they all were assembled very well and at a good price. In the first year-and-a-half, I would have given them 5 stars because they always came in good shape and "ready to use" right out of the ... box. However, since that first period, the quality of the 9x6x3 boxes have steadily gone down. I purchase these size boxes by the 100 pack and my last purchase had about 75% usable boxes. The term "usable" is exactly how it sounds, that I can work with some of the defects and still use the boxes to send packages. I'd say 60% of the original 100 needed no "work" and I could use them as-is. The other 15% of the usable boxes needed some work to get them in "ship shape". The rest of the 100 were basically scrap cardboard (which have some uses). Again, these defects (which I list below) were encountered only on the 9x6x3 boxes, of which I use the most. The other sizes I have ordered have been reasonably good quality. So, the 3 star rating instead of 2.Recent defects, past year (the boxes are 2 pieces that are glued together to make the box): - Box is assembled wrong type 1: The separate pieces are "off" severely and the box, when folded into shape has a 1/2 inch open gap at the top or bottom on one side. This leads to severe box integrity issues and is susceptible to easy crushing and/or other loss of strength. - Box is assembled wrong type 2: The separate pieces are "off" modestly and the box, when folded into shape has small 1/3 inch (diameter) holes at the corners which, unless taped over, can lead to foreign objects like dirt, bugs, etc.. entering the package. The box integrity is also affected. - Box is assembled wrong type 3: The separate pieces are "off" slightly and the box, when folded into shape has a "bowing" effect. That is, its sides are not at reasonable right angles. If viewed from the side, a closed, taped up box, has a slight curve almost like a parenthesis. The box integrity is also affected. - Box is cut wrong: The box is not cut right and, when closed up for shipping has 1/4" or more gap where you wouldn't want one. This requires extra packing tape to secure the box. - Box adhesive is poor: Some boxes are "falling apart" at the adhesion points which makes a "stuffed" box unusable without a lot of supporting packing tap. - Boxes packed poorly: Some boxes have folds, bends, etc... on the flat surfaces which make it look "bad" when sending items out (if you're a seller).On top of the recent defects, the price (as expected) has slightly increased over the years. So with the increased price with increased defects has made me look for another source.

Perfect for the upscale bookseller!
A great size for standard hardbacks and trade paperbacks. Typically, you can get two volumes (wrapped in paper) inside; single volume shipments require an air pillow or some type of packing. At around 3 1/2 oz in weight, it can be something to watch for on volumes that are under the one pound limit. I use this box on more expensive volumes wherein I want to make a nice, clean impression with the arrival of the package. The box is unmarked except for a single bottom panel which contains the standard box certificate, a Recycle logo, and a "Made in America" label. These sturdy containers are more expensive than cutting carboard flats from used stock but they definitely upgrade the look and feel of your final package! I use them judiciously but regularly.

They are great for the price
They are great for the price. Every now and then, I have to take the box apart at the seam to reposition the tab and tape it all back together as it was incorrectly glued. But I would continue to order them. I do wish the boxes were lighter actually. I use these for 1st class shipments and the boxes weigh almost 4 ounces, so when the postal website calculates shipping, my customer has the option to choose 1st class shipping as long as the contents are under 13oz...but often the weight of the box makes it so that I have to send the item via Priority. But when I put it into a priority box, it is once again, under the limit for 1st class. So obviously, priority boxes are lighter than these. Again...not enough of a problem to make me stop ordering them.
